You have not answered my question so I guess I'll put it here again...What physical security features (on the exterior of the un-opened block) are present in this product that would make it impossible to copy?
As I stated previously,
I have no issue with the key generation. I will list my concerns below so it's not difficult to understand:
1) The design is simple. There is no unique texturing or elements that would be difficult to copy on the titanium block or card.
2) Fonts (typeface) used in the design are all free fonts accessible to anyone with the internet (Avenir, Helvetica, Times New Roman, ect..)
3) The logo used in the design is available on the internet
4) There is no holographic "sticker"
5) The scratch off and sticker covering the private key are 2D and would be possible to mimic
6) The exact dimensions of the block are posted online
7) The layout (front view) is available on this thread

The block # & reward stickers could potentially fall off over time (not a security concern)
My physical security concerns also apply to the Ballet cards. I'm concerned and giving feedback so these security issues could potentially be addressed. A product intended to hold a significant amount of BTC should be scrutinized in my opinion.
